Book excerpt: This book, unique in its field, is a comprehensive description of all the methodologies reported for carrying out conjugate addition reactions in a stereoselective way, using small chiral organic molecules as catalysts (organocatalysts). In the last 3-4 years, this has been a rapidly growing field in organic chemistry, and many papers have appeared reporting excellent protocols for carrying out these highly efficient transformations that compete well with other classical approaches using transition metal catalysts. A particularly attractive feature of this transformation relies upon the fact that the conjugate addition (Michael and Hetero-Michael reactions) is an extraordinarily effective means to initiate cascade processes which result in the formation of complex molecules from very small and simple starting blocks. Book excerpt: The organocatalytic asymmetric conjugate addition of carbon nucleophiles and heteroatom nucleophiles to electron deficient nitroalkenes is an important tool for the synthesis of highly functionalized building blocks for applications in medicinal and synthetic organic chemistry. Although the enantioselective conjugate addition reactions of -nitrostyrenes are well known, the corresponding conjugate addition reactions of - nitrostyrenes are not reported. The present study examines the organocatalytic asymmetric, enamine-mediated conjugate addition reaction of aldehydes or cyclic ketones to -nitrostyrenes that were generated in situ from the corresponding nitroacetates. The details of this study are described in Chapter 2 of this thesis. The utility of the above methodology was demonstrated by application in the formal total synthesis of 4-aryl indolizidine alkaloids, (+)-lasubine II and (-)-subcosine II. The organocatalytic Michael addition of 1,4-cyclohexanedione monoethylene ketal to an appropriate -nitrostyrene which were generated in situ from the corresponding nitroacetate gave the key -nitroketone which was used as the starting material in the alkaloid synthesis. The details of this study are described in Chapter 3. Finally, an enantiomerically enriched -nitroketone obtained from the organocatalytic Michael addition of 1,4-cyclohexanedione monoethylene ketal to a - nitrostyrene has been utilized in the synthesis of a recently isolated indolizidine alkaloid, (+)-fistulopsine B, which is of interest due to its anticancer activity. Details of this investigation are described in Chapter 4.
